Jurang, Yan et Bin, Liu, Oscillatory and Asymptotic Behaviour of Fourth Order Nonlinear Difference Equations, Acta Mathematica Sinica, New Series Chinese Journal of Mathematics, 13(1), 1997, pp. 105-115
This paper considers a class of fourth order nonlinear difference equations .² (r..² y.)+ f(n, y.) = 0, n . (n.), where f(n,y) may be classified as superlinear, sublinear, strongly superlinear and strongly sublinear. In superlinear and sublinear cases, necessary and sufficient conditions are obtained for the difference equation to admit the existence of nonoscillatory solutions with special asymptotic properties. In strongly superlinear and strongly sublinear cases, sufficient conditions are given for all solutions to be oscillatory.
